Understanding Listeria and Its Threat to Health

Listeria monocytogenes is a bacterium that causes listeriosis, a serious infection primarily contracted through contaminated food. Unlike many other foodborne pathogens, Listeria can survive and even multiply at refrigeration temperatures, making it a stealthy threat in cold-stored foods like deli meats, soft cheeses, and unpasteurized dairy products. The infection can range from mild symptoms to life-threatening complications depending on the individual’s immune response.

The question “Can Your Body Fight Off Listeria?” hinges on how well your immune system reacts to the bacterium. For healthy adults, the body’s defenses often contain and eliminate the bacteria without severe illness. However, for pregnant women, newborns, elderly individuals, and those with weakened immune systems, the stakes are higher. In these groups, Listeria can breach natural barriers more easily and cause invasive disease such as meningitis or septicemia.

The Immune System’s Role Against Listeria

Your immune system is a complex network designed to detect and destroy invading pathogens like Listeria. The process begins when specialized cells recognize bacterial components and trigger an immune response.

Innate Immunity: The First Line of Defense

Innate immunity acts immediately upon infection. Macrophages and neutrophils engulf Listeria bacteria through phagocytosis. These cells release signaling molecules called cytokines that recruit more immune cells to the site of infection.

However, Listeria has evolved strategies to evade this initial defense. It can escape from the phagosome (a compartment inside macrophages) into the cytoplasm of host cells where it replicates safely away from many immune attacks. This intracellular lifestyle complicates clearance by innate immunity alone.

Adaptive Immunity: Targeted Attack

The adaptive immune system kicks in after a few days and provides a more precise response. T cells play a crucial role here:

    • CD8+ cytotoxic T cells identify infected host cells displaying Listeria antigens and kill them directly.
    • CD4+ helper T cells produce cytokines that enhance macrophage killing capacity.

This targeted approach is usually effective at clearing intracellular Listeria if the adaptive immune system is functioning properly.

Factors Influencing Your Body’s Ability to Fight Off Listeria

Not everyone mounts an equally strong defense against this pathogen. Several factors affect your body’s ability to overcome listeriosis:

Age and Immune Competence

Young children and elderly adults have weaker or less responsive immune systems. This reduced immunity means they are less capable of controlling bacterial replication before it spreads beyond the gut.

Pregnancy: A Unique Vulnerability

During pregnancy, the immune system undergoes modulation to tolerate the fetus. This immunological shift reduces certain cell-mediated responses that are critical for combating intracellular pathogens like Listeria. Consequently, pregnant women face increased risk of systemic infection that can harm both mother and fetus.

Underlying Medical Conditions

Conditions such as HIV/AIDS, cancer chemotherapy, organ transplantation (requiring immunosuppressive drugs), diabetes, or chronic kidney disease impair various aspects of immunity. These patients often fail to mount sufficient responses against intracellular bacteria.

Genetic Factors

Some individuals have genetic variations affecting their innate or adaptive immunity which may influence susceptibility or severity of listeriosis.

The Course of Infection: How Your Body Responds Over Time

Listeriosis typically begins after ingestion of contaminated food. The bacterium crosses intestinal barriers using specialized proteins that allow it to invade epithelial cells.

Once inside tissues:

    • Early phase: Innate immunity attempts containment; mild symptoms like fever or diarrhea may appear.
    • If containment fails: Bacteria disseminate via bloodstream (bacteremia) leading to systemic infection.
    • Severe phase: Infection reaches central nervous system causing meningitis or infects placenta during pregnancy.

The speed and effectiveness of your immune response determine whether you experience mild illness or severe complications.

Treatment Options When Your Body Can’t Fight Off Listeria Alone

While some cases resolve naturally due to robust immunity, many require antibiotic treatment because Listeria is resistant to common antibiotics like cephalosporins used for other bacterial infections.

The standard treatment includes:

    • Ampicillin or amoxicillin: These beta-lactam antibiotics target bacterial cell wall synthesis.
    • Gentamicin: Often combined with ampicillin for synergistic effect in severe cases.
    • Treatment duration: Typically 2-6 weeks depending on severity and patient risk factors.

Prompt diagnosis and therapy are crucial since delayed treatment increases mortality risk drastically.

The Science Behind Immunity Against Intracellular Bacteria Like Listeria

Listeria’s ability to hide inside host cells presents a unique challenge compared to extracellular bacteria. The immune system requires specialized mechanisms:

    • Cytotoxic T lymphocytes (CTLs): Detect infected cells presenting bacterial peptides via MHC class I molecules; CTLs induce apoptosis of these cells.
    • Nitric oxide production by macrophages: Activated macrophages generate reactive nitrogen species toxic to intracellular bacteria.
    • Cytokine signaling: Interferon-gamma (IFN-γ) produced by T helper cells activates macrophages enhancing their killing power.
    • B cell involvement: Although antibodies cannot reach intracellular bacteria directly, they neutralize extracellular forms during transmission phases.

A coordinated interplay between these components determines if your body successfully controls infection.

The Role of Vaccines in Enhancing Immunity Against Intracellular Pathogens Like Listeria?

Currently no licensed vaccine exists for human use against listeriosis despite ongoing research efforts due to its complex intracellular lifecycle. Experimental vaccines focus on stimulating strong cellular immunity targeting key bacterial proteins.

Vaccination could one day provide an extra layer of protection especially for high-risk populations by priming adaptive responses before exposure occurs.
